Output 323338d58b107c836a376e5d5ee4efb46c5245c4c50d2b227e65e4d48ac5bef7:25

value
15189269
script pubkey
OP_0 OP_PUSHBYTES_20 b7c999c26da2d211a26ee0d2fb5c78e02a690f82
address
bc1qklyensnd5tfprgnwurf0khrcuq4xjruz6h8hej
transaction
323338d58b107c836a376e5d5ee4efb46c5245c4c50d2b227e65e4d48ac5bef7